The hexadecimal color code #046259 corresponds to the code RGB( 4, 98, 89 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,02 level), green (at 0,38 level) and blue (at 0,35 level). Its brightness is 20% and its saturation is 92%. It is composed of red at 2%, green at 51% and blue at 46%.

The complementary color #FB9DA6 is the color exactly opposite to #046259 on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#046259 in CSS

When using #046259 as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#046259 as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
